Our CT Technologist operates Computed Tomography imaging equipment to produce cross-sectional images of the patient’s body for diagnostic purposes.

Responsibilities Would Include

  • Interviews patient to explain computed tomography imaging procedures and ensures removal of those metal objects which can prevent successful imaging. Prevents others from entering the room when the CT machine is scanning.
  • Positions patient on examining table in the correct orientation and close to area of interest, following protocols requested by Radiologist.
  • Demonstrates use of microphone that allows patient and technologist to communicate during examination.
  • Performs phlebotomy as needed to safely inject contrast media as indicated and approved by hand and by automated pump. Skill with using both butterfly and angiocath.
  • Enters data such as patient history, anatomical area to be scanned, orientation specified, and position of entry into aperture of computed tomography imaging equipment (head or feet first), into computer.
  • Keys commands to specify scan sequences and adjust parameters into computer.
  • Observes patient through window of control room to monitor patient safety and comfort and communicates regularly with patient to assure comfort and compliance.
  • Views images of area being scanned on video monitor to ensure quality of acquisition datasets.
  • Modify CT sequence parameters as needed to achieve optimal results
  • Moves dicom datasets to destinations and storage per policy and procedure
  • Alerts and controls access to anyone about to enter the CT room to the danger of entering a radiation emitting area. Acts as a gatekeeper to maintain a safe environment.
  • Stops scanning immediately if problems arise. Stops injecting immediately if problems arise.
  • Solves problems in real time and escalates when necessary for quality and patient safety.
  • Participates in the training of CT students in their clinical rotation as needed
  • Performs x-ray procedures as needed, following the requirements within the Xray Technologist job description.
